Aldreds are pleased to offer this nicely presented three/four bedroom semi detached house, situated in the sought after Broadland town of Stalham. This well appointed property offers accommodation including an entrance hall, ground floor shower room, bedroom/study, lounge, kitchen/diner, three first floor bedrooms and bathroom. The property offers storage heating, a well maintained nicely enclosed rear garden, garage en-bloc, off road parking and the recent installation of PV solar panels. Entrance Hall - Part glazed entrance door, storage heater, cloaks cupboard, power points, stairs to first floor landing, doors leading off;

Ground Floor Shower Room - Windows to front and side aspects, low level w.c., panelled shower cubicle, storage heater.

Study/Ground Floor Bedroom 4 - 3.37m x 2.84m (11'0" x 9'3") - Sliding patio doors leading to rear garden, storage heater, power points.

Lounge - 5.03m x 3.34m (16'6" x 10'11") - Window to rear aspect, storage heater, power points, television point, pebble effect wall mounted electric fire.

Kitchen/Diner - 5.03m x 2.49m (16'6" x 8'2") - Two front facing windows, tiled flooring, built-in cupboard, open fronted cupboard with space for tumble dryer, range of fitted kitchen units with rolled edge work surface and tiled splash back, sink drainer with mixer tap, space for cooker with extractor over, plumbing for washing machine and dishwasher, storage heater.

First Floor Landing - Loft access, airing cupboard housing hot water cylinder and immersion heater, doors leading off;

Bedroom 1 - 5.03m x 2.54m reducing to 2.17m (16'6" x 8'3" redu - Two front facing windows, storage heater, power points, fitted wardrobe with sliding doors, attractive views across the road to farmland beyond.

Bedroom 2 - 2.73m x 2.41m (8'11" x 7'10") - Window to rear aspect, storage heater, power points.

Bedroom 3 - 2.43m x 2.22m (7'11" x 7'3") - Window to rear aspect, storage heater, power points.

Bathroom - Obscure glazed window to side aspect, tiled walls, white suite comprising of pedestal hand wash basin, low level w.c., panelled corner bath with mixer tap and shower attachment.

Outside - The property occupies a pleasant corner plot position with a generous garden nicely enclosed with close board panel fencing to boundaries, laid to lawn with surrounding patio areas and timber garden shed. A pedestrian gate gives access to garage en-bloc area, where the property offers a garage with parking in front.

Pv Solar Panels - PV solar panels were installed at the property in June 2024 as part of a North Norfolk District Council grant.

Location - Stalham is a popular Broadland town with its own range of facilities, which include a public staithe on the upper reaches of the River Ant, health centre, library, post office, infant, junior and high school, a variety of High Street shops and supermarket.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
